AI智能体时代新蓝图:开放智能体网络的构建路径

一、AI智能体:从工具到生态的核心跃迁

AI智能体的发展已进入”自主决策+环境交互”的新阶段。区别于传统AI模型的单向输入输出模式,现代智能体具备三大核心特征:环境感知(通过多模态传感器实时获取状态)、任务分解(将复杂目标拆解为可执行子任务)、协作网络(与其他智能体或系统动态交互)。

以工业场景为例,某主流云服务商的智能质检系统已实现:

  1. # 智能体协作示例:缺陷检测与分拣
  2. class QualityAgent:
  3. def __init__(self, vision_model, robot_arm):
  4. self.detector = vision_model # 视觉检测模型
  5. self.executor = robot_arm # 机械臂控制器
  6. def inspect_and_sort(self, product_stream):
  7. while True:
  8. product = product_stream.get()
  9. defects = self.detector.analyze(product)
  10. if defects:
  11. self.executor.move_to(defect_bin)
  12. else:
  13. self.executor.move_to(pass_bin)

这种架构要求智能体具备低延迟决策(<100ms响应)、容错恢复(网络中断时保存上下文)和安全边界(物理操作限制)能力。某行业常见技术方案最新发布的智能体框架已支持毫秒级状态同步,误操作率降低至0.3%。

二、开放智能体网络:技术架构与实现路径

构建开放网络需解决三大技术挑战:协议标准化安全互信资源调度。当前主流方案采用分层架构:

1. 通信协议层

基于改进的HTTP/3协议,定义智能体间交互的标准化接口:

  1. POST /api/v1/agent/interact HTTP/3
  2. Content-Type: application/agent-msg+json
  3. {
  4. "sender_id": "agent_001",
  5. "context_hash": "a1b2c3...",
  6. "action": {
  7. "type": "request_service",
  8. "payload": {
  9. "service": "image_recognition",
  10. "params": {"url": "..."}
  11. }
  12. },
  13. "security_token": "jwt_signed_token"
  14. }

关键设计包括:

  • 上下文哈希:确保状态一致性
  • 服务能力声明:通过元数据描述智能体功能
  • 动态路由:基于QoS的请求分发

2. 安全互信层

采用零信任架构与区块链存证结合方案:

  • 身份认证:基于硬件TPM的双向证书验证
  • 行为审计:所有交互记录上链存证
  • 沙箱隔离:每个智能体运行在独立容器

某安全实验室测试显示,该方案可抵御99.7%的中间人攻击,同时将认证延迟控制在15ms以内。

3. 资源调度层

针对异构计算资源,设计三级调度机制:

  1. 全局调度器:基于Kubernetes的智能体实例管理
  2. 边缘节点:5G MEC设备上的轻量级运行时
  3. 终端适配:Android/iOS设备的本地推理引擎

性能优化实践表明,采用动态批处理(Dynamic Batching)技术可使GPU利用率提升40%,响应延迟降低25%。

三、开发者实践指南:从0到1构建智能体网络

1. 开发环境搭建

推荐技术栈:

  • 框架选择:支持多后端的智能体开发框架
  • 工具链:集成调试器与可视化监控面板
  • 模拟环境:数字孪生系统模拟真实场景

典型开发流程:

  1. graph TD
  2. A[需求分析] --> B[能力建模]
  3. B --> C[协议设计]
  4. C --> D[本地开发]
  5. D --> E[沙箱测试]
  6. E --> F[网络部署]
  7. F --> G[持续优化]

2. 关键能力实现

上下文管理:采用分层存储方案

  1. class ContextManager:
  2. def __init__(self):
  3. self.short_term = LRUCache(100) # 短期记忆
  4. self.long_term = Database() # 长期存储
  5. def get_context(self, agent_id, window_size=5):
  6. recent = self.short_term.get(agent_id)
  7. historical = self.long_term.query(agent_id, limit=window_size)
  8. return merge_contexts(recent, historical)

协作机制:实现基于意图的动态组队

  1. public class TeamFormation {
  2. public List<Agent> formTeam(Task task, List<Agent> candidates) {
  3. return candidates.stream()
  4. .filter(a -> a.getCapabilities().containsAll(task.getRequirements()))
  5. .sorted(Comparator.comparingDouble(a -> a.getTrustScore()))
  6. .limit(task.getTeamSize())
  7. .collect(Collectors.toList());
  8. }
  9. }

3. 性能优化策略

  • 通信优化:采用gRPC+Protobuf替代REST
  • 计算卸载:将非实时任务迁移至边缘节点
  • 模型压缩:使用知识蒸馏技术减小模型体积

测试数据显示,优化后的智能体网络吞吐量提升3倍,平均响应时间从1.2s降至380ms。

四、未来演进方向与行业影响

开放智能体网络将推动三大变革:

  1. 服务原子化:所有功能解耦为可组合的智能体服务
  2. 经济系统:基于区块链的智能体服务交易市场
  3. 自治生态:通过联邦学习实现的群体智能进化

某研究机构预测,到2027年,60%的企业应用将采用智能体架构,其中80%会接入开放网络。开发者需重点关注:

  • 协议兼容性:优先支持行业通用标准
  • 安全设计:从开发初期嵌入零信任机制
  • 可观测性:构建全链路监控体系

结语

AI智能体时代的竞争,本质是开放生态的竞争。通过标准化协议、安全架构和高效调度机制,开发者可构建出具备自组织、自进化能力的智能体网络。建议从业者从单点智能体开发入手,逐步向网络化协作演进,同时关注行业标准的制定进程,在技术变革中占据先机。